Symptoms
Error log ('show support') contains one or more instances of "CI2CBus::Access() failed for slave 0x40" error; for example:
<
code:
163
>
code:
Dec 13 09:37:35 10.19.98.17 NIM[2.tBcPoEAccs]doI2cAccess:

code:
CI2CBus::Access() failed for slave 0x40 on NIM 1


Power over Ethernet (PoE) may not be working on a group of ports on the referenced module slot.

Cause
Given that module slots are identified in messages as "[<slot>.<task>]" and that "slave 0x40" refers to the PoE microcontroller , this particular message means that there is an I2C bus issue with the PoE microcontroller on a slot 2 module NIM.

Solution
Ensure that the PoE power header (looks like four parallel pins) is installed so that the NIM's RJ45 ports can physically receive PoE power.
See the "S-Series Option Module Quick Reference" guide, for more about the power header.

Contact the GTAC for assistance, as necessary.
